Overview

Step into the shoes of Plug in "1000 Amps," an indie adventure puzzle-platformer developed and published by Brandon Brizzi. Released in February 2012, this single-player experience tasks you with a crucial mission: restoring the expansive Amp-Tree-System and uncovering the secrets of an enigmatic intruder.

The game invites players to explore a vast, interconnected world filled with challenges that can be tackled in any order, offering a true sense of freedom.

Highlights

  • Players embody Plug, tasked with restoring the Amp-Tree-System and confronting an unknown threat.
  • Key mechanics include illuminating the environment by touching objects and teleporting into unoccupied spaces with a simple click.
  • The game features an open-world design with over 150 rooms to explore, offering power-ups and challenges in a non-linear fashion.

Game Info

Developed and published by Brandon Brizzi, "1000 Amps" falls into the Adventure and Indie genres. It supports single-player gameplay and includes Steam Achievements.

The game was released on February 22, 2012, and is available in English. Players can save their progress at any time, allowing for flexible play sessions.

The core gameplay loop revolves around solving puzzles by manipulating light and utilizing a unique teleportation ability to navigate over 150 intricately designed rooms.
